Galaxy Z Flip 4 will have the Snapdragon 8 Gen 1+ chip

There are still at least three months to go before the new leaflets of Samsung, but some information is already starting to leak. Indeed it appears that Galaxy Z Flip 4 can use the new chip in the output of QualcommThe powerful Snapdragon 8 Gen 1+.

Galaxy Z Flip 4 will have the Snapdragon 8 Gen 1+ chip

According to the latest leaks, the new folding Samsung’s Galaxy Z Flip 4 will use the new Snapdragon 8 Gen 1+. A chip yet to be announced but which is expected to use TSMC’s 4-nanometer processor. Compared to the current top of the range (the Snapdragon 8 Gen 1, without the ‘plus’), it should be more powerful. In fact it will have frequencies from 3.19GHz with single Cortex-X2 CPU core, 2.75GHz with C0rtex-A710 CPU core, and 1.8GHz with Cortex-A510 CPU core.

It seems that the device will also have well 8GB in RAMto make you fly Android 12 (with One UI 4.5 available immediately). With this configuration, the first benchmarks report results from 1,277 single-core points and 3,642 multi-core pointsa really powerful CPU.

The other information about the small foldable from Samsung reports really interesting data. The foldable display should be from 120Hzwhile the battery will come to 3.700mAh with recharge from 25W (there will also be wireless charging). The fingerprint reader will be lateral, the speakers will be stereo. It should have a certification IPX8.

At the moment there is no information regarding the configuration of the cameras. But it seems evident that Samsung wants to launch a top of the range in all respects, with a foldable display and a really cool design.
